Pithecellobium might sound like a spell from a fantasy novel, but it's actually a fascinating genus of flowering plants that deserve a spot in the spotlight. Nestled within the vast Fabaceae family, Pithecellobium's story spans from the tropical regions of America to the varied landscapes of Southeast Asia. These plants, particularly famous in Central and South America—say in countries like Mexico and Venezuela—are well-known for their unique living adaptations. With varieties blooming year-round and providing essential ecological benefits, Pithecellobium plants play a significant role in their native environments.

Pithecellobium species consist of around a hundred different kinds, each offering its own distinct style and benefits. Despite their varied uses, many people overlook the potential of these plants. In their native habitats, they provide resources for local wildlife, offering nutritious fruits and seeds that birds and mammals rely on.
